Box Score BOSTON, Mass. – Even with Alex Frapech leading the floor with 19 kills on the night, the Emerson Men's Volleyball Team fell 21-25, 25-20, 25-22 and 25-21 Wednesday night to the Emmanuel Saints. With the loss the Lions are now 5-5 on the year and 0-2 in conference play as Emmanuel improves to 3-4 overall and 2-0 in the GNAC.
The Lions came out to light it up in the first set as they swung .294 as a team with Alex Frapech locking in to hit .800 in the set with four kills to lead the set. Brendan McGonigle stepped up as well for EC, swinging .400 for three kills in the set as the Lions went head-to-head with the Saints. While Emmanuel battled back forcing 12 tie scores and six lead changes in the end it was Emerson that prevailed.
Set two saw the Saints lock in though as they rallied back from the first set loss to throw down .345 as a team as Ashanti Jackson lit things up with a perfect five-for-five performance to lead Emmanuel. The Lions couldn't seem to find the same rhythm that they did in the first set with 10 unforced errors as the Saints ripped off with a 25-20 win to even it.
Set three proved to be a gritty battle on both sides as the score found itself tied on more than six occasions throughout. Alex Frapech exploded in the set, leading the floor with an unreal nine kills in the set. The Saints pieced it together as a team though, even as Emerson outhit them .346 to .333, taking a .25-22 win.
While the Lions fired up again in the fourth for seven tie scores and two lead changes, the Saints defense was too much for Emerson in the end as they post four blocks in the set. Frapech was fantastic again with four kills in the set, which was matched by Emmanuel's Wyatt Cooper with a .600 attack percentage as the Saints closed out the 25-21 final.
